Combination Web-based and Classroom Courses:
Combination web-based and classroom training is a convenient way for students to learn First Aid, CPR and the use of an Automated External Defibrillator (AED). Also available is training for the professional rescuer and an Oxygen Administration course.
-
The first portion of the training is completed online at the student’s convenience
-
For the second part of the training, a Red Cross instructor conducts a skills session where participant skills are practiced and assessed in a classroom setting
